About SafelyYou
SafelyYou’s mission is to empower safer, more person‑centered care across senior living through AI, industry‑changing hardware, and remote expert clinicians, improving outcomes for residents while giving families peace of mind and reducing costs for communities.
Founded in 2015 from research at UC Berkeley’s AI Lab, SafelyYou addresses key challenges in senior living—from resident falls and ER visits to staffing, length of stay and NOI—ensuring communities can focus on care while achieving financial goals.
SafelyYou is recognized in the Senate Falls Report (2019), named a McKnight’s Tech Partner of the Year, and listed on Fortune’s Impact 20 for improving lives through innovation.
Your Role at SafelyYou
The Install Coordinator is the operational backbone of the installation process, ensuring seamless execution of in‑room sensor deployments while Implementation Managers focus on customer‑facing tasks. The role bridges Implementation Managers, agents and field technicians, providing real‑time support, resolving install blockers and maintaining accuracy, timeliness and quality.
We are building a culture that believes technology can make care more human—creating safer, calmer, more connected communities for residents, caregivers and families. You’ll play a key part in ensuring every SafelyYou deployment meets our high standards.
Key Responsibilities
- Manage day‑to‑day install operations for all active installations: track progress, coordinate schedules and resolve blockers.
- Handle installation escalations such as late or damaged shipments, special mounting considerations, alternate cable routing, inaccessible power outlets or mounting locations.
- Conduct virtual walkthroughs with community maintenance teams or field technicians to confirm sensor placement and validate completed installations.
- Perform quality checks for sensor view and IR settings upon completion to ensure full system functionality.
- Coordinate Wi‑Fi assessments with field technicians to confirm network readiness and identify connectivity concerns ahead of time.
- Partner with vendors and shipping teams to ensure timely and accurate delivery of all equipment.
- Submit work orders, monitor progress and verify adherence to SafelyYou’s documentation requirements and install standards; provide proactive communication to resolve field issues or delays.
